How about something like this jsFiddle? It uses the direction, text-align, and text-overflow to get the ellipsis on the left. According to MDN, there may be the possibility of specifying the ellipsis on the left in the future with the left-overflow-type
value however it’s considered to still be experimental.
p {
white-space: nowrap;
overflow: hidden;
/* "overflow" value must be different from "visible" */
text-overflow: ellipsis;
width: 170px;
border: 1px solid #999;
direction: rtl;
text-align: left;
}
<p>first > second > third<br /> second > third > fourth > fifth > sixth<br /> fifth > sixth > seventh > eighth > ninth</p>
